Sound file won't play over several slides--starts over

I have a PPT with five different songs on it. All of them work except one.
The one starts on the proper slide, but when advancing to the next slide, it
starts over. I have it listed as "start automatically." Also, it is listed to
go across 5 slides. It does not "end at end of slide" or "end with click."

Interestingly, when I click "view presentation" from the animation window
and it starts from the slide, it works fine. When I play the presentation
from the beginning, it doesn't.
